Abstract
In this paper, we construct the super Witt algebra and super Virasoro algebra in the framework of the -deformed quantum algebras. Moreover, we perform the super -deformed Witt -algebra, the -deformed Virasoro -algebra and discuss the super -Virasoro -algebra ( even). Besides, we define and construct another super -deformed Witt -algebra and study a toy model for the super -Virasoro constraints. Relevant particular cases induced from the quantum algebras known in the literature are deduced from the formalism developped.
